Behavioral Upset in Medical Patients-Revised: Evaluation of a Parent Report Measure of Distress for Pediatric Populations

Abstract:Examined the utility of a new parent-report measure designedspecifically for pediatric inpatients, the Behavioral Upsetin Medical Patients-Revised (BUMP-R). The BUMP-R was administeredto 151 mothers of hospitalized children ages 4–12 yearsthe day following the child's hospital admission. The BUMP-Rdemonstrated good internal consistency and a factor analysisrevealed four factors identified as negativity/agitation, amiability,dysphoria, and noncom-pliance. Children exhibiting behavioraldistress at home were more likely to experience adjustment problemsupon hospitalization. Demographic and illness-related variableswere not substantial risk factors for hospital adjustment difficulties.
